А. Yu. Alekseev is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Infectious Diseases and Agronomy and Crop Science. According to data from OpenAlex, А. Yu. Alekseev has authored 72 papers receiving a total of 558 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 40 papers in Epidemiology, 33 papers in Infectious Diseases and 12 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science. Recurrent topics in А. Yu. Alekseev's work include Influenza Virus Research Studies (33 papers), Viral Infections and Vectors (19 papers) and Animal Disease Management and Epidemiology (12 papers). А. Yu. Alekseev is often cited by papers focused on Influenza Virus Research Studies (33 papers), Viral Infections and Vectors (19 papers) and Animal Disease Management and Epidemiology (12 papers). А. Yu. Alekseev collaborates with scholars based in Russia, Japan and United States. А. Yu. Alekseev's co-authors include А. М. Шестопалов, Kirill Sharshov, Olga Kurskaya, Ivan Sobolev, Мarsel R. Kabilov, Victor Irza, David E. Swayne, Dong‐Hun Lee, Michael A. Shestopalov and Yuri V. Mironov and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
